Client expertise (UX) variables to consider
Concentrate on presenting a sleek and interesting customer practical experience by lowering massaging variables and earning probably the most of methods. Carry out efficiency tests to accumulate remarks and repeat with your design.
In the course of the event therapy, testing plays A necessary job in guaranteeing the applying’s major high quality and ability. Builders carry out numerous kind of testing, that contains Device tests, adaptation tests, and buyer authorization screening, to ascertain and fix insects, Enhance usefulness, and enhance the distinct practical experience. Looking at is often a recurring treatment, with builders consistently adjust the appliance dependent on steps and evaluating benefits.
When buying a system, components to take into account
Factors such as target audience demographics, budget strategy, timeline, and wished-for capabilities will Unquestionably affect your method selection. Each and every technique has its rewards and restraints, so think about your selections thoroughly.
Comply with UI structure Concepts including instinct, simpleness, and harmony to produce a cosmetically interesting and tempting interface. Pay attention to typography, coloration scheme, and searching patterns.
Cell application Application Improvement advancement has actually completed up remaining An important Component of the digital landscape, with a lot of programs simply provided all over numerous programs. When the applying is related to ready for launch, builders mail it to the specific application merchants (e.g., Apple Software Store, Google Play Keep) for consent.
Along with the features finished up, builders can begin creating the application. This typically requires generating code, creating the user interface, and integrating countless components such as information means, APIs, and third-bash therapies. Depending on the procedure (apple apple iphone, Android, or cross-platform), developers might utilize many packages languages and advancement frameworks to bring the application to life.
The journey does not finished with the applying’s start. Constant updates and upkeep are necessary to hold the application perfect and cost-effective within the at any time-evolving mobile landscape. Developers analyze buyer feedbacks, keep track of performance metrics, and start updates routinely to deal with problems, consist of new characteristics, and adapt to modifying market place crazes.
Put up-launch aid and updates
Provide reoccuring aid and updates to manage consumer actions, fixing bugs, and current new options. Routinely view on software efficiency metrics and client communication to identify spots for advancement.
Internet marketing arrives near to for application launch
Acquire an in-depth internet marketing and promoting approach which contains pre-start introductories, influencer partnerships, socials media Employment, and press release to acquire Excitement and drive customer order.
Cell application improvement has in fact happened a crucial Component of the digital landscape, altering the methods corporations entail with their shoppers and other people contain with contemporary innovation. In this particular detailed critique, we will certainly find the treatment of cell software progress from fertilizing to launch, masking all the things you need to acknowledge to make a reputable cell application.
Truly worth of wireframing and prototyping
Use wireframing and prototyping equipment to generate mockups and versions of one's software right before advancement begins. This lets you envision the private stream, Assemble stakeholder remarks, and make educated design and style selections.
As promptly as being the thought is strengthened, the checklist underneath phase calls for defining the application’s efficiency and buyer encounter. This is where wireframing and prototyping turn into Component of Participate in, making it achievable for builders to photo the appliance’s layout and searching structure. With feedbacks and variants, developers Increase the structure and person interface to guarantee a clean and instinctive shopper working experience.
Really worth of cell purposes in currently’s digital landscape
In today’s chaotic environment, cellular purposes have in truth wound up getting an important gadget for each companies and customers. For companies, mobile programs give a custom-made and straight community for connecting with shoppers, driving interaction, and acquiring earnings. For shoppers, cell programs source ease, schedule, and easy shopper experiences.
As rapidly as the appliance is associated with Completely ready for start, developers deliver it to the equal application suppliers (e.g., Apple Software Keep, Google Perform Keep) for consent. Software store entrance is made up of keeping with extensive criteria and approaches designed via the system small business, containing desires hooked up to format, Online, and protection and security Online page. On authorization, the appliance stands for download to clientele all over the world.
As swiftly because the theory is Increased, the adhering to exercise is usually to define the applying’s attributes and performance. This is made up of creating wireframes and mockups to visualize the consumer interface and customer experience. It is critical to concentrate on functions based on their relevance and usefulness, preserving in mind areas for example improvement time, finances method constraints, and technological facts.
Mobile software advancement has definitely completed up being an essential ingredient in the electronic landscape, with numerous apps effortlessly made available during several techniques. When the applying is associated with Prepared for launch, builders mail it to the specific application retailers (e.g., Apple Application Retail outlet, Google Participate in Store) for permission. Cellular software innovation has really completed up currently being A vital ingredient of the electronic landscape, with many applications presented in the course of many methods. For clientele, mobile applications offer usefulness, program, and smooth client experiences.
Among the initial action in the innovation treatment is advertising and marketing exploration. Developers have to assessment the economical landscape, discover goal demographics, and look at precise actions to acquire understandings that notify the application’s style and traits. Acknowledging the needs and solutions of your target market is significant for building an application that resounds with individuals and stands out in a very jampacked sector.
Finishing up documents protection and information protection and protection remedies
Utilize defense methods and safeguarded affirmation treatment plans to safeguard fragile certain information and facts and Stop unauthorized relieve of entry.
Deciding on the appropriate hard cash producing system on your application
Testimonial your software’s target audience, really worth referral, and marketplace styles to acknowledge among Probably the most fantastic hard cash creating solution. Evaluation a lot of variations and repeat based on buyer remarks and performance information.
The inexpensive nature of the application industry implies developers have to situate techniques to differentiate their software from the numerous Other people competing for folks’ emphasis. This calls for not basically an captivating truly worth referral yet furthermore highly regarded advertising and marketing and price cut tactics to produce and protect people.
The journey of mobile application development frequently commences by having an notion– a cause of inspiration that manages a certain need or solves a aspects worry. This idea capabilities because the framework whereupon your complete enhancement therapy is designed. Transforming a principle ideal into a completely useful software asks for aware prep perform and software.
As quickly as the application is pertained to All set for start, builders deliver it to your equal application retailers (e.g., Apple Application Retail outlet, Google Participate in Retail store) for permission.
Improving earnings utilizing customer participation and retention
Concentrate on creating perfect use private communication and retention utilizing custom made internet material, gamification, push notifications, and commitment systems. The lots additional dedicated and engaged your clients are, the way more incomes chances you’ll have.
Mobile software improvement has truly wound up being a significant aspect with the digital landscape, with a lot of programs provided all over many units. From social networking to video clip clip Computer system gaming, effectiveness gizmos to coaching methods, mobile programs please a tremendous choice of desires and alternatives. With this brief compose-up, we’ll uncover the nuances of cell software development, through the Original principle through product, and speak with regards to the essential variables to acquire into account and limitations related Using the remedy.
Advantages and drawbacks of each and every procedure form
Native programs employ the ideal general performance and purchaser working experience Yet involve various development for every and each and every method. Crossbreed applications make use of expenditure and time financial Value cost savings nevertheless could Give up performance. World wide web programs occur in the course of many gizmos yet may possibly do not have specific aboriginal features.
Executing sector exploration
Conduct extensive marketplace investigate to comprehend your target market, rivals, and market designs. Decide places over the marketplace and options for innovation that the application can gain from.
With the look finished, developers can commence the event section, where the application’s code is generated and executed. According to the process (apple apple iphone, Android, or both of those), designers could make use of various systems languages and enhancement frameworks to create the application. Cross-platform enhancement applications such as React Indigenous and Flutter have truly obtained allure in current occasions, utilizing developers the capability to develop code when and start it throughout numerous systems.
Stability is an added substantial issue in cellular application development, delivered the fragile aspects routinely seemed following by purposes, for instance distinct details, economic facts, and location info. Designers have to have to accomplish resilient defense steps, for instance safety and stability, affirmation, and danger-free aspects storage home, to safe purchaser individual privateness and secure vs . unauthorized get to.
Take note of irrespective of whether you plan to develop a local application (particularly founded to get a singular process), a crossbreed application (which might work several programs using a singular codebase), or even a Web application (accessed using a World-wide-web browser).
Debugging and examining
Entirely inspect your software throughout different units, functioning systems, and network troubles to choose and set up treatment of almost any kind of pests or success problems. Accomplish automated screening equipment and approaches to spice up the tests App Developer therapy.
Next personal privateness requirements
Retain to working day with personal privateness designs such as the General Details Security Regular (GDPR) as well as the California Shopper Personal Privacy Act (CCPA) to be sure consistency and set up rely on with your customers.
At the heart of mobile application advancement exists The concept generation stage. This is when developers conceive concepts, Have a look at market place tendencies, and accept consumer demands beforehand up with an affordable application concept. No matter whether it’s managing a certain problem or pleasing a particular requirement, an efficient application basic principle need to resound with its target audience and supply an exceptional worthy of pointer.
Defining the function and targets of one's software
Start off by Plainly defining the attribute and features of the mobile software. Possessing a distinct eyesight will definitely guide the innovation cure and assurance that your software meets the requires of your respective target sector.
Application store optimization (ASO) procedures
Transform your application keep listings with important search term expressions, involving recaps, costs visuals, and appealing shopper evaluates to boost visibility and downloads.
Selecting the right applications language
Pick out a programs language and innovation framework that exceptional satisfies your work prerequisites and group knowledge. Popular choices consist of Java (for Android), Swift (for apple apple iphone), and Answer Aboriginal (for cross-System enhancement).
Mobile software advancement describes the cure of building software application applications which are specifically designed to operate with clever telephones for instance pill Computer system devices and good telephones. These apps can provide a substantial selection of purposes, from pleasure and performance to conversation and Firm.
Standard security and security audits and updates
Carry out standard security and security and basic safety and safety audits and seepage tests to establish susceptabilities and lessen potential threats. Retain hostile in addressing defense dangers and right away launch areas and updates as required.
Regardless of the probable positive aspects, mobile application advancement involves its sensible share of difficulties. Amongst One of the more significant challenges is technique fragmentation, with numerous products operating unique variants of working systems and present measurements. This range causes it to be examining to make sure program effectiveness and certain experience through all gizmos.